“…55 The IL-33/ST2 axis is necessary to prevent host mortality by modulating granuloma-mediated pathology in schistosomiasis mansoni. 56 In experimental schistosomiasis, the IL-33/ST2 axis has been associated with increased Th2 response in infections with S. japonicum, 20 but not with S. mansoni. 56 IL-33 has been reported as one of keystones in liver inflammatory diseases, with protective or proinflammatory effects, depending on assessment timing and disease models.…”

“…After perfusion, the lungs, liver, spleen and intestine (small and large) were removed, triturated and individually digested in potassium hydroxide solution (5% KOH) at 37°C for 4 h. The product of the tissue digestion of each animal was centrifuged (1500 g for 5 min), and the sediment containing the eggs was washed 5 times and resuspended in 5 mL of saline solution containing 10% formaldehyde. For counting, two 200- μ L aliquots of each sample were analysed using an optical microscope, and the average number of eggs per aliquot of digested tissue suspension was expressed in eggs/organ (Maggi et al , 2021).…”
